Output 3ca6820d5d8b7638ece0686417ed9db14ebf8414bd64e58fb562ca052391d3fd:12

value
1642146
script pubkey
OP_0 OP_PUSHBYTES_20 d71eee41c995ae471521443d561a26ff8956c046
address
bc1q6u0wuswfjkhyw9fpgs74vx3xl7y4dszxmp50wh
transaction
3ca6820d5d8b7638ece0686417ed9db14ebf8414bd64e58fb562ca052391d3fd
confirmations
159983
spent
true